Probability of a 3 on the first roll = 1/6
Probability of a 3 on the second roll = 1/6
Probability of both of them = (1/6) x (1/6) = 1/36 = 0.0277777 = 2.78% (rounded)

Let A be the event of rolling a 4. P(A) = 1/6 P(A)P(A)=(1/6)(1/6)=1/36 Therefore, the probability of rolling a 4 twice with two rolls of a number cube is 1/36.
Because 3/6 of the sides on a number cube have even numbers, the probability of rolling even on one number cube is 1/2(equivalent of 3/6). But since you're rolling twice, you multiply the probability of one by itself (therefore rolling 2 number cubes). So: 1/2x1/2=1/4 The probability of rolling an even number when a number cube is rolled twice is 1/4, 25%, or 1 out of 4.
